Redwire’s move occurred on elevated volume compared to recent sessions, suggesting institutional accumulation rather than mere short-term speculation. The company, which specializes in space-based sensors, solar arrays, and on-orbit manufacturing, has been drawing attention as the satellite and defense sectors see increased budget allocations. Broader industry tailwinds, including growing demand for low-earth orbit (LEO) satellite constellations and government contracts for space logistics, have bolstered sentiment for pure-play space infrastructure names. Redwire’s recent contract wins and its positioning in the crewed spaceflight segment may be contributing to the upside. The stock’s gain outpaced the broader market, with the S&P 500 and Nasdaq Composite showing modest gains on the same day. The space sector as a whole has been volatile, but Redwire’s ability to hold above the $15 psychological level suggests near-term buyer conviction. At the current price, the company’s market capitalization reflects a premium compared to some smaller space peers, though revenue growth expectations remain a key driver of valuation. From a technical standpoint, Redwire’s price action shows a clear breakout from the $14.50–$14.80 consolidation range that had persisted over the prior two weeks. The stock closed near the session high, indicating buying pressure remained intact into the close. Relative strength index (RSI) readings are in the mid-50s, suggesting the move has not yet entered overbought territory, leaving room for further upside. The moving average convergence divergence (MACD) line is approaching a potential bullish crossover, while the 50-day moving average, currently near $14.20, has served as a solid floor. Resistance at $16.12—a level that capped rallies in late January—remains the immediate hurdle. A sustained move above that zone could open a path toward the $17.00–$17.50 area, where prior supply emerged. On the downside, the $14.58 support level is reinforced by the 200-day moving average, which sits just below, providing a safety net in case of a pullback. Volume analysis shows that the buying was broad-based, with accumulation-distribution lines trending higher. Looking ahead, Redwire’s near-term trajectory may depend on the company’s ability to convert its pipeline of government and commercial contracts into realized revenue growth. The upcoming earnings report, expected within the next few weeks, could serve as a catalyst. If the company delivers stronger-than-expected top-line results or provides optimistic guidance, the stock could test and potentially break above the $16.12 resistance level. Conversely, any disappointment regarding margins or contract delays might trigger a retreat toward the $14.58 support. Broader macro factors, such as interest rate expectations and overall risk appetite in the small-cap space, could also influence RDW’s performance. The space industry’s cyclical nature means that sentiment can shift quickly based on headline news. Traders should monitor volume patterns around key levels; a failure to sustain above $15.50 could indicate exhaustion. While the current momentum is constructive, a cautious approach—waiting for a confirmed breakout above $16.12 or a pullback to support—may be prudent. Any future contract announcements or government budget decisions could further shape the stock’s outlook.
